Playlist Strategies That Work for Emerging Musicians

Getting your recordings heard as an indie musician can feel like shouting into the void, but strategic song list placement offers a powerful avenue for discovery. Don't simply submit to every playlist you find; instead, prioritize those aligned with your sound. Research editors – many are active on social media and welcome direct communication. Craft a compelling message highlighting why your track is a perfect fit. Consider creating your own themed playlists showcasing your music and similar artists to attract potential listeners and curators. Finally, remember that consistent marketing of your submissions can significantly boost your odds of being featured.

Attracting Visitors with Indie Playlists: A Musician's Handbook

Getting discovered in today’s saturated music scene can feel overwhelming, but leveraging independent playlists provides a powerful avenue for reach. Many listeners actively seek out curated playlists, offering a fantastic opportunity to get your songs in front of a targeted audience. Thoughtfully pitching your singles to playlist curators, both established and niche, is crucial; build rapport and genuinely engage with their content. Don't just spam – offer something of interest like suggesting similar artists they might enjoy, showcasing your understanding of their brand. Finally, remember to analyze your playlist performance using analytics to refine your approach and see what's truly clicking with listeners.
